Recognizing Efficient Irrigation Systems



Different Irrigation approaches exist, comprehending efficient Irrigation systems is vital for maximizing water use in agriculture. Efficient Irrigation encompasses innovations and strategies designed to provide water straight to plants in a regulated manner, lessening waste and taking full advantage of performance. Typical approaches, such as wrinkle and flooding Irrigation, frequently lead to significant water loss via dissipation and drainage. On the other hand, contemporary systems, consisting of drip and sprinkler Irrigation, allow for targeted application, making sure that plants get the exact quantity of water required for development.


Farmers must examine aspects such as soil kind, crop needs, and environment problems when selecting an irrigation system. In addition, the assimilation of smart innovations, like dampness sensors and automated controls, can better enhance performance. By embracing effective Irrigation methods, farming stakeholders can conserve water resources, minimize expenses, and advertise lasting farming, ultimately adding to the durability of farming systems when faced with environment adjustment.

Water Preservation Techniques



As water deficiency becomes an increasingly pressing issue, the adoption of sophisticated Irrigation techniques emerges as a crucial technique for promoting lasting agriculture. These methods include drip Irrigation, which delivers water straight to plant roots, reducing dissipation and drainage. In addition, rainwater harvesting systems capture and shop rain for later usage, optimizing water accessibility. Dirt wetness sensors better enhance water preservation by supplying data-driven understandings on Irrigation demands, permitting accurate water application. Mulching assists preserve soil wetness and minimizes the requirement for frequent Irrigation. By executing these water conservation methods, farmers can significantly reduce water use, lower functional prices, and add to ecological sustainability, ensuring that farming techniques remain sensible despite environment challenges.

Improving Crop Yields and High Quality



Efficient Irrigation systems not just save water however additionally play a vital function in improving plant returns and high quality. By providing exact quantities of water straight to the origin zones, these systems reduce water stress and anxiety on plants, leading to much healthier development and greater productivity. Constant moisture levels cultivate perfect conditions for nutrient uptake, leading to robust plant growth. In addition, improved Irrigation techniques minimize the risk of overwatering, which can create nutrient leaching and root illness, ultimately boosting crop quality.


In addition, efficient Irrigation assists in the administration of soil salinity, which can adversely affect crop efficiency. By keeping appropriate dampness levels, these systems contribute to better soil structure and fertility. The mix of improved water monitoring and boosted plant health and wellness leads to higher yields and remarkable fruit and vegetables, fulfilling the needs of both customers and markets. Consequently, purchasing efficient Irrigation is important for attaining sustainable farming methods that prioritize yield and top quality.
